The Way, Way Back

Comedy, Written by Nat Faxon and Jim Rash.
Release Date: July 5th, 2013.



I linked this on FaceBook because this is my dream cast. Steve Carell is a proven talent, but Allison Janney is one of my favorite humans, plus Toni Collette is immensely gifted. To say I'm looking forward to this is a gross understatement. You better not disappoint, Nat Faxon and Jim Rash!!! Who am I kidding. Those two are a delight. (I miss Ben and Kate)

RED 2

Action, Screenplay by Jon Hoeber, and Erich Hoeber.
Release Date: July 19th, 2013.



Ehh, this will probably be mediocre at best. But the original RED was an unexpected smash for me. I love a film that doesn't take itself super seriously (I'm looking at you, Die Hard series) and if I get to watch Helen Mirren kick ass again, I'll give this a shot.

The To Do List

Romantic Comedy, Written by Maggie Carey.
Release Date: July 26th, 2013



Everyone seems to love Aubrey Plaza lately, but I don't think I'm on that bandwagon. She is pretty funny and this movie has summer success formula written all over it. With some hysterical costars, and jokes that make me giggle in the trailer, I'm pretty excited to see how this shakes out.
